Euro-Med Monitor Reveals Circumstances Of A Massacre Committed By the Occupation In Jabalia

Geneva-(ST)- The Euro-Mediterranean Human Rights Monitor revealed the results of an investigation into the circumstances of a massacre committed by the Israeli occupation in the Jabalia refugee camp in northern Gaza Strip last December.

The Monitor said in a statement on Thursday: “The investigation showed that the massacre committed by the occupation in the Al-Faluja area of ​​Jabalia camp was carried out using American-made bombs with enormous destructive capacity,” noting that several “Israeli” air strikes bombed the community, which included residential buildings housing hundreds of displaced people which caused the death of about 120 Palestinians, most of them were from one family.

It added: “the bombing, within seconds, led to leveling buildings to the ground and massively destroying other buildings, and causing holes in the ground of which three reach a depth of about 2.5 meters, while some of them were about 10 meters in diameter.”

The Monitor confirmed that this massacre represents a war crime and a full-fledged crime against humanity committed by the occupation army against civilians as part of the ongoing crime of genocide against the Palestinian people in Gaza Strip.

The Monitor called on the International Criminal Court to expedite the issuance of arrest warrants and hold the occupation leaders accountable for their crimes against the Palestinians.
